Health officer held for graft sent to judicial custody
The health department’s district programming manager, Nabhendra Singh Bhati, was sent to 14-day judicial custody by a local court on Wednesday.
Bhati was arrested by the Anti-Corruption Bureau (ACB) for taking a bribe of ₹1.5 lakh on Tuesday evening.
Giving detailed information about the incident, deputy superintendent of ACB in Alwar, Saleh Mohammad said that Dr Hari Mohan Saini of Vedanta Hospital in Rajgarh had complained to the bureau against Bhati. Dr Saini told the bureau that he had applied to the office of chief health and medical officer (CMHO) for an agreement under government’s Janni Suraksha Yojana. On April 5, CMHO Dr Punkaj Gupta and his brother Amit Gupta suddenly came to his hospital and took away the attendance register charging the hospital authorities of irregularities and asked Dr Saini to meet the district programming manager in Alwar office over the issue.
